Output cc660999768efa35d709efea431362a260254b36ea27fa917a2e6223ac33c649:4

value
133519
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9159da2809c80b6a4101d333d0902a3f1d7e4bf7 OP_EQUALVERIFY OP_CHECKSIG
address
1EFYcrXR4yDvsRidbm3pJpKoK5JzD19KCz
transaction
cc660999768efa35d709efea431362a260254b36ea27fa917a2e6223ac33c649
confirmations
261771
spent
true